The type of religion is not the problem, its how the religion is practiced.

Even Zen Buddhism which preaches peace and harmony was sucked into supporting the brutality of Japanese militarism in World War 2. Consider this: A famous quote is from Harada Daiun Sogaku (Rōshi of the Sōtō school : "[If ordered to] march: tramp, tramp, or shoot: bang, bang. This is the manifestation of the highest Wisdom [of Enlightenment]. The unity of Zen and war of which I speak extends to the farthest reaches of the holy war [now under way]

In Nichiren Buddism there is a concept which I think describes this well. The Devil King of the 6th Heaven (Buddhism uses a lot of analogy to describe ideas).

"The devil king of the sixth heaven, the king who makes free use of others' efforts for his own pleasure, is so called because it dwells in the highest of the six heavens of the world of desire. We could think of it as the embodiment of the devilish nature of power. The devil king of the sixth heaven can be thought of as the fundamental tendency to seek to use everything and everyone as a means. In this sense, this is a natural inclination that all beings possesses....The universe and one's own life are in essence are one. Even though people may understand this intellectually, usually they fail to grasp it in the depths of their lives. This could be termed fundamental darkness. Because of this ignorance about the true nature of life, people try to make everything and everyone in the universe serve them, to turn them into a means'.

The Wisdom of the Lotus Sutra Volume III, Daisaku Ikeda. p54

Does the end justify the means?

Consider what Machiavelli has to say on this subject:

In the actions of all men, and especially of princes, where there is no court to appeal to, one looks to the end. So let prince win and maintain his state: the means will always be judged honourable, and will be praised by everyone.


Note that Machiavelli says "means will always be judged honourable" not that they are honourable. The Prince may be seen as a satire on the subject of absolute power rather than a primer on how to keep it. Some say that this quote was plagiarized by Machiavelli and actually originates with Ovid.
